Definition of ingenuity - Reverso English Dictionary

Noun

1.
clevernessquality of being clever and inventive
  • Her ingenuity helped her fix the broken radio.
creativity inventiveness resourcefulness
2.
creativityingenious device or act
  • The new gadget was a product of sheer ingenuity.
contrivance invention masterstroke
Add a suggestion |

Origin of ingenuity

Latin, ingenium (natural capacity) + -ity (state or condition)
